      Marvin Noland Connor was born on October 3rd 1968 in the city of San Fernando, and later moved to the Five Rivers, Arouca, where he attended the Fiver Rivers Hindu School (1973 - 1980), and then graduated to Five Rivers Secondary and Senior Secondary Schools (1981-1987). During his tenure at school, he was an active member of both the school’s football team and Steel pan.

      Marvin’s interest in the Steel pan led him to attend the M.I.C - Steel pan Manufacturing Ltd (1993 - 1994) where he attained the following skills:
       Pan Manufacturing
       Metallurgy of Carbon Steels
       Spinforming
       Basic Welding and Sheet Metal Work
       The Principles of Music
       Environmental Awareness
       Personality and Social Development
       Basic Bench Fitting and Measurement
       Basic Calculations and Applied Science
       Small Business Development and Marketing

      In 1995, Marvin accepted the Lord Jesus Christ as his personal Lord and Savior at the Five Rivers Church of the Nazarene, and later took up membership at the Arouca New Testament Church of God where he is very active.

      With continued interest in the field, Marvin was given the opportunity to play for several Local steelbands, and arrange for both local and international bands as well. Some of there include, but not limited to:
       Curepe Scherzando - Section Leader
       Phase 2 Pan Groove
       Potential Symphony
       Kingdom Covenant (Canada 2000) - Arranger
       Arouca Worship Centre Steel Orchestra - Arranger

      With such ‘hands-on’ experience, he was granted the opportunity to Lecture at the Caribbean Nazarene College - The Development of Steel pan, The history of Steel pan and Steel pan Manufacturing.

      Marvin currently resides in Arouca with his beautiful wife Lydia, and is a proud father of two girls, Jamilia and Akyia, and one son, Josiah.

      Renegades is playing 'Dr. Jit'; a composition of The Original DeFosto Himself. Amrit recommended this selection to the band even before the members had heard the tune. The band was leaning towards playing 'pan baby' but when they heard Dr. Jit, the decision was almost unanimous. If I may say so myself the calypso is a splendid tribute to Jit Samaroo, and Amrit in his arrangement has tried to interpirt Jit by including little samples of his father's past works including a little snipet of one of his Indian compositions
